
Prop, Joe Jones re signs with Doncaster Knights
21st April 2025
Doncaster Knights are delighted to announce that front row, Joe Jones, will remain at the club for 2025/26.
Jones brings brilliant experience to the squad, having played rugby in Wales, England and France. He wracked up over 50 caps for premiership side, Sale Sharks before returning to Doncaster Knights last season.
This season, Jones has made 70 tackles in just over 600 minutes of rugby, earning a 96% success rate for his tackling.
